|
|
|
ช่วยดู Code ให้ด้วยคะ ไฟล์ไม่เข้าโฟเดอร์และไม่ลงฐานข้อมูลด้วย |
|
|
|
|
|
|
|
upload.php
<?php
$number_of_file_fields = 0;
$number_of_uploaded_files = 0;
$number_of_moved_files = 0;
$uploaded_files = array();
$upload_directory = dirname(__file__) . '/FileUpload/';
for ($i = 0; $i < count($_FILES['userfile']['name']); $i++) {
$number_of_file_fields++;
if (is_uploaded_file($HTTP_POST_FILES['userfile']['tmp_name'][$i])) {
$number_of_uploaded_files++;
$uploaded_files[$i] = iconv("UTF-8", "TIS-620", $HTTP_POST_FILES['userfile']['name'][$i]);
$fileRand = '';
for($i = 0; $i < 5; $i++) {
$fileRand .= chr(rand(97, 122));
}
$uploaded_files[] = $fileRand.date("YmdHis").$_FILES['userfile']['name'][$i];
copy($HTTP_POST_FILES['userfile']['tmp_name'][$i], $upload_directory.$uploaded_files[$i]);
$number_of_moved_files++;
}
}
echo "Number of File fields created $number_of_file_fields.<br/> ";
echo "Number of files submitted $number_of_uploaded_files . <br/>";
echo "Number of successfully moved files $number_of_moved_files . <br/>";
echo "File Names are <br/>" . implode(',', $uploaded_files);
?>
save.php
$date = date("Y-m-d H:i:s");
$strSQL = "INSERT INTO shareDiscus (Department,Subject,Recipients,Detail,Createby,Modified,FilesName)
VALUES('".$_POST[txtDepartment]."','".$_POST[txtTitle]."','".$_POST[txtRecipient]."','".$_POST[txtDetail]."','$Fname $Lname','$date','$uploaded_files[$i]')";
$objQuery = mysql_query($strSQL) or die(mysql_error());
Tag : PHP, MySQL
|
|
|
|
|
|
Date :
2011-07-11 15:49:52 |
By :
chokul |
View :
17731 |
Reply :
1 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Load balance : Server 00
|